Ingredients for Baked Egg Cups with Ham and Cheese

Ingredient Quantity
Large Eggs 6
Diced Ham 1 cup
Shredded Cheese (Cheddar, Swiss, or your choice) 1 cup
Milk ¼ cup
Salt ½ teaspoon
Pepper ¼ teaspoon
Olive Oil or Cooking Spray For greasing
Chopped Fresh Herbs (optional) Tbsp (e.g., parsley, chives)

Step-by-Step Directions

Now that we have our ingredients ready, let’s dive into the step-by-step process to create these delicious Baked Egg Cups with Ham and Cheese!

  1. Preheat the Oven: Start by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C).
  2. Prepare the Muffin Tin: Grease a standard muffin tin with olive oil or cooking spray to prevent sticking.
  3. Mix Ingredients: In a large mixing bowl, whisk together the eggs, milk, salt, and pepper until well combined.
  4. Add Ham and Cheese: Fold in the diced ham and shredded cheese into the egg mixture. If you’re using fresh herbs, add them at this stage for an extra flavor boost.
  5. Fill the Muffin Tin: Pour the egg mixture evenly into each muffin cup, filling each about ¾ full to allow for rising.
  6. Bake: Place the muffin tin in the oven and bake for 20-25 minutes, or until the egg cups have puffed up and are set in the center.
  7. Cool and Serve: Remove the muffin tin from the oven and let it cool for a few minutes. Use a butter knife to gently edge around the cups for easier removal. Serve warm or allow to cool completely and store for later use!

FAQ

1. Can I make Baked Egg Cups ahead of time?

Absolutely! Baked Egg Cups can be made ahead and stored in the refrigerator for 3-4 days. You can reheat them in the microwave or enjoy them cold.

2. What other ingredients can I add to the Baked Egg Cups?

The beauty of this recipe lies in its versatility. You can add vegetables like spinach, bell peppers, or mushrooms. Additionally, you can substitute the ham with cooked bacon, sausage, or even smoked salmon for different flavor profiles.

3. Can I freeze Baked Egg Cups?

Yes! Once cooled, you can freeze Baked Egg Cups in an airtight container for up to three months. When you’re ready to eat them, simply thaw overnight in the refrigerator and reheat as desired.
